Social & Digital Media Assistant
Role Responsibility
We are looking for a highly motivated individual to join our small team to develop and deliver social and digital media content as well as digital marketing campaigns for the Public Protection* Group of services. This is an exciting time to be working with Public Protection as it is at the forefront of supporting communities, residents and businesses during the COVID-19 pandemic and beyond. We need a committed team player to support the Public Protection Services by increasing service engagement with the target audiences, raising awareness of the services and promoting commercial business services through effective online marketing and communication.
You don’t need to have lots of experience but you do need to have the relevant knowledge, training and skills to deliver effective social media communications and digital marketing campaigns, including the production and editing of videos. You will receive support, coaching and guidance from a social media / digital marketing expert to develop your skills and knowledge further and to implement what you have learnt.
For the foreseeable future, the post holder will be required to work from home but must be able travel to Maidstone, Kent (or other locations in Kent) for meetings as and when required. This post is offered as a 9 month contract to support the Public Protection Commercial and Customer Information Team during a period of maternity leave.
This post is considered by KCC to be a customer-facing position. The Council therefore has a statutory duty under Part 7 of the Immigration Act (2016) to ensure that post holders have a command of spoken English/Welsh sufficient for the effective performance of the job requirements. The appropriate standards are set out in the Job Description/Person Specification.
*For the purposes of this role, KCC’s Public Protection Group includes Trading Standards, Kent Scientific Services Laboratory, Community Safety Unit, Intelligence Service, Resilience & Emergency Planning.
